Biography

I am an ethnologist whose research interests focus on the moral and epistemological dimensions of medical practice, the experiences of those affected by humanitarian aid, and the institutionalization of global health education. I have been conducting ethnographic research in Haiti since 1997 and have also led research projects in the United States and the Dominican Republic. I teach courses on medical anthropology theory, epistemology, the Caribbean, mental health, and research methodology. I am available to work with postdoctoral researchers and graduate students who wish to conduct research in these areas.
